The Furnace Creek Inn provides a list of more than four dozen movies filmed at least in part
in the area. These include Star Wars , Spartacus , and King Solomon's Mines . Television shows filmed
here include Tarzan , Death Valley Days , and an episode of The Twilight Zone .
President Hoover named Death Valley a national monument in February 1933. In 1994, Death
Valley became a national park, making it the largest park in the continental United States.
High summer temperatures discourage many visitors. Most tourism is in the winter, spring,
and fall, and the inn is available to guests from mid-October through mid-May. In the hot months,
from mid-May through mid-October, all operations are consolidated at the Furnace Creek Ranch.
The mission-style inn is a AAA four-diamond property. The nearby Furnace Creek Ranch offers
224 family-oriented accommodations.
